Copy This! How I turned Dyslexia, ADHD, and 100 square feet into a company called Kinko's
Copy This! How I turned Dyslexia, ADHD, and 100 square feet into a company called Kinko's

Details 

A Story of how a struggling kid who could barely read, write, or sit still managed to grow a 10x10 foot copy stand into a $2 billion business empire. This surprisingly candid memoir of turning lemons into lemonade is filled with wisdom, humor, and inspired Orfalea Aphorisms. What's to become of a hyperactive boy with dyslexia who can't sit through a full lesson and who spends more time in the principal's office than in class? If he is Paul Orfalea, he turns potentially overwhelming challenges into strategic opportunities and grows up to nurture a small copying firm into a $2-billion-a-year operation called Kinko's. This effervescent memoir tells how he did it, not least by making the most of his advantages. Written with wit and style, this book offers much to inspire readers with obstacles to overcome or who march to a different drummer. 2007, soft cover, 226 pages.

How Difficult Can This Be? FAT City Workshop
How Difficult Can This Be? FAT City Workshop

Details 

Richard Lavoie presents striking simulations which allow viewers to experience the same FAT (frustration, anxiety, tension) that children with learning disabilities face in their daily lives. Video DVD format only 70 minutes, 1990 (DVD contains special features - extensive new interview with Richard Lavoie)
